Ceros operates NO MCP server. This file is an API Evangelist candidate design derived from the four operations in the current Public API — it is not published by Ceros, is not callable, and must not be presented as a Ceros surface.

Tools
ceros_get_current_account— Resolve the API key to its account name and accountResourceId.ceros_get_folder_tree— Return the folder hierarchy of an account, optionally expanded and depth-bounded.ceros_list_folder_experiences— List experiences directly inside a folder, with search, sort and paging.ceros_get_embed_codes— Return embed snippets and serving URLs for an experience.
About MCP
The Model Context Protocol (MCP) is an open protocol Anthropic introduced for connecting LLM-based agents to external tools and data sources. Providers publish MCP servers that expose their API surface as structured, discoverable tools — an MCP-compatible client (Claude Desktop, Cursor, Cline, Continue, etc.) can connect to the server and call its tools without any per-provider integration code.
